Understanding the James Webb Space Telescope and Its Mission

First things first, what exactly is the James Webb Space Telescope? Well, it's not just any telescope; it's a monumental achievement in engineering and a giant leap for humankind. Designed as the successor to the Hubble Space Telescope, the JWST is the most powerful telescope ever built, and is revolutionizing our understanding of the cosmos. Its primary mission is to observe the universe in infrared light, allowing it to peer through dust clouds and see objects that are otherwise invisible to the human eye or other telescopes. This includes the very first galaxies formed after the Big Bang, exoplanets, and the formation of stars and planetary systems.

The JWST is a collaborative project between NASA, the European Space Agency (ESA), and the Canadian Space Agency (CSA). Launched in December 2021, the telescope is located about a million miles away from Earth at a point called the second Lagrange point (L2). This location provides a stable thermal environment, crucial for the sensitive infrared instruments to function optimally. The telescope's massive, 6.5-meter primary mirror, made up of 18 hexagonal segments, collects an enormous amount of light. This advanced design, along with its cutting-edge instruments, enables the JWST to capture images and data with unprecedented clarity and detail. The telescope's capabilities surpass anything we've seen before, providing scientists with the tools they need to unlock the secrets of the universe. The mission of JWST is to study every phase in the history of our universe, ranging from the first galaxies to the formation of stars, and the possibility of life on exoplanets.

So, what does all of this mean for us? For starters, it gives us a chance to witness the universe in ways we never thought possible. The JWST is equipped with four main scientific instruments: the Near-Infrared Camera (NIRCam), the Near-Infrared Spectrograph (NIRSpec), the Mid-Infrared Instrument (MIRI), and the Fine Guidance Sensor/Near Infrared Imager and Slitless Spectrograph (FGS/NIRISS). These instruments work in tandem to collect light and data, which are then processed into the stunning images and scientific findings that we see. What Makes JWST Images So Special?

So, what's all the buzz about? What makes the JWST images so exceptionally special? Well, the JWST is the most advanced space telescope ever built. It's designed to see the universe in infrared light, which lets it peer through dust clouds and observe objects that are invisible to visible-light telescopes like the Hubble. This gives us a whole new perspective on the cosmos. The JWST's massive, 6.5-meter primary mirror collects more light than any previous space telescope. The larger the mirror, the more light it can gather, and the more detailed the images it can produce. This means the JWST can capture images of incredibly distant and faint objects, like the first galaxies that formed after the Big Bang.

The JWST's instruments are also incredibly sensitive. It can detect the faint infrared light emitted by distant objects, allowing scientists to study the composition, temperature, and other properties of celestial bodies. Moreover, the JWST's images aren't just pretty pictures; they're packed with valuable scientific data. Each image tells a story about the universe. It helps scientists understand how galaxies form, how stars are born, and if there's any chance of life on exoplanets. JWST is also located far from Earth, at a point called the second Lagrange point (L2). This location gives it a stable thermal environment, which is crucial for its infrared instruments to function properly. The lack of interference from Earth's atmosphere and the sun enables the JWST to capture incredibly sharp and clear images. The JWST's images are a testament to the power of human ingenuity. They provide an unprecedented view of the universe, and will undoubtedly change our understanding of the cosmos.

The Impact of JWST Discoveries on Our Understanding of the Universe

The James Webb Space Telescope is making a HUGE impact on our understanding of the universe. Imagine going back in time to the very beginning, to the first galaxies. With the JWST, we're getting closer to this with every new image. The telescope's ability to see through dust and gas clouds gives us a chance to see galaxies as they were billions of years ago. It helps scientists learn how they formed and evolved. The JWST is also helping us study the formation of stars and planetary systems. The telescope can peer into the heart of star-forming regions, revealing the processes that lead to the birth of new stars and planets.

One of the most exciting areas of research is the study of exoplanets, planets that orbit stars other than our sun. The JWST is equipped to analyze the atmospheres of exoplanets, looking for signs of water, methane, and other molecules that could indicate the presence of life. This is a huge step in the search for extraterrestrial life. JWST is giving us detailed data and it helps refine our models of the universe. The discoveries are constantly challenging existing theories and sparking new ones. The JWST data enables us to see the cosmos through new eyes, revealing details we never knew were possible.
